“Relevance builds brands. Control just increases the risk of irrelevance.” In this episode of The Persuasion Game, we’re joined by Nathalia Amadeu, Global Brand Director at Vaseline, to explore how the 150-year-old brand is reinventing itself in the social-first era. It centres on the hugely successful Vaseline Verified campaign (winner of nine awards at the Cannes International Festival of Creativity, including a Titanium Lion). A campaign which, as Nathalia puts it - “challenged decades of brand control thinking.” With millions of people already sharing their own ways of using the product, instead of leading the conversation, Vaseline chose to listen. The result is a new model of brand building - one that validates, amplifies and co-creates with its community. That shift in approach is not just a campaign idea, it is also reshaping innovation, with new products, co-built with creators, in production.
